Product Overview: S2J-13 from Diodes Incorporated
The S2J-13 is a high-performance rectifier diode, designed and manufactured by Diodes Incorporated, a leading global manufacturer and supplier of high-quality application-specific standard products within the broad discrete, logic, analog, and mixed-signal semiconductor markets.
Key Features
- High Surge Capability: The S2J-13 is designed to withstand high surge currents, making it ideal for applications requiring robust surge protection.
- Low Forward Voltage Drop: It features a low forward voltage drop, which enhances power efficiency by minimizing losses during conduction.
- High Reliability: With its glass passivated chip, the S2J-13 offers high reliability and stability over its operational life.
- Lead-Free and RoHS Compliant: The product is environmentally friendly, adhering to the Restriction of Hazardous Substances (RoHS) directive, making it suitable for use in green products.
Electrical Characteristics
The S2J-13 boasts impressive electrical characteristics that make it suitable for a wide range of applications. It can handle a repetitive peak reverse voltage of up to 600V and has a forward continuous current of 2A, ensuring it can cope with moderate power demands. Its fast switching capability enhances performance in circuits where efficiency is key.

Package and Quality Assurance
The S2J-13 is available in a DO-214AA (SMB) package, which is compact and suitable for automated assembly processes. Diodes Incorporated ensures that each product meets rigorous standards for quality and performance, providing customers with a reliable component for their electronic designs.
